hmm...i've just done a fresh install of QCD and replace the installed files with the aquified files, and i get an error that there is no playback plugin selected. i then get taken to a dialogue where i should select a playback plugin but there is nothing listed.

any thoughts?
0

#20 User is offline   siddharth Icon

  • Group: Member
  • Posts: 2,191
  • Joined: 08-November 02

Posted 01 December 2002 - 09:30 AM

First uninstall QCD and delete the directory. Reinstall QCD Player....don't install the tweaked QCD yet...
Configure the player with plugins and skins and whatever...Then replace the QCD files with the tweaked files..

After you do so you can run QCD Player and now all the configuration options are still available, there is a small bug with configuring plugins if you replace the exe before doing so....
